Job description

Software Developer-Onsite Position (Inter)

Are you an innovative and flexible self-starter? Do you have keen software engineering skills? We’re looking for highly motivated Software Developer to join our world class organization in Ottawa, ON .

You will live and breathe embedded software design to help us create the latest in embedded systems technology. We need enthusiastic t eam players who want to share, discuss, and brainstorm ideas with our top-notch engineering team at our dynamic organization.

We Take Care of Our People

Paid Time Off I RRSP with Employer Match I Health and Wellness Benefits I Learning and Development Opportunities I Competitive Pay I Referral Program I Recognition I I

Engineer, Design, Develop and Test new embedded products at the forefront of technology.

Support and enhance existing embedded software.

Apply established development processes and assist in process improvement.

Analyze requirements, research and identify solutions and develop the design.

Conduct architecture, design and code reviews.

Provide input to architecture and design reviews.

Provide input and evaluation of new technologies and products.

Keep current with embedded software trends and share knowledge.

Reading and understanding IC datasheets, register descriptions and board schematics.

Participate in maintaining a positive and productive atmosphere within the team.

What You Bring :

Development of embedded firmware solutions for Intel, Power Architecture and Arm processors.

Proficient using the high-level programming language such a C to solve computing problems and a strong understanding of IC datasheets, register descriptions and board schematics.

Strong troubleshooting, problem solving, and software debugging skills.

Strong understanding of software design and engineering principals and application to real world use.

Results-oriented team player who leads by example, holds themselves accountable for performance, takes ownership of their responsibilities, and champions process improvement initiatives.

Bachelor's Degree in Engineering or Computer Science (or equivalent).

Experience / familiarity in the following is an asset :

Experience working with a multi-disciplined team.

Knowledge of software engineering best practices and standards.

Focus on writing supportable, portable code.

Das U-Boot firmware development for ARM or Power Architecture.

Slim Bootloader (SBL) development for Intel.

Bare metal programing.

Board bring-up.

Familiarity with the following OS architectures; Linux, VxWorks, and Windows.

Software configuration management tools such as Git.

Software work and defect tracking tools such as JIRA.

Software test tools and methodologies.

Scripting tools and languages such as Python.

Requirements analysis and tracking.

Familiarity with any of the following technologies : PCIe, Ethernet, MDIO, I2C, SPI, TPM, non-volatile memories, SATA, USB, eMMC, NVMe.

Use of HW debugging tools, such as Digital Analyzers, Oscilloscopes, and DMMs.

Who We Are :

Curtiss-Wright creates a wide variety of embedded computer products designed for the rugged defense industry. Our customers want the latest cutting-edge consumer technology adapted to a rugged form factor and our mission is to make that a reality!As part of a dynamic multi-disciplined team, your job will be to support the development of new embedded systems products, and to enhance our existing products.
